
在Excel表格中标注拼音声调,方法主要包括:使用Unicode字符、借助拼音输入法、利用Excel函数。其中,使用Unicode字符是一种较为直接且灵活的方法。详细描述如下:在Excel中标注拼音声调时,可以通过插入Unicode字符来实现。例如,ǎ的Unicode编码是U+01CE,可以通过输入“=UNICHAR(462)”来生成带声调的拼音字母。接下来,我们将详细介绍这三种方法,并探讨其优缺点和具体操作步骤。
一、使用Unicode字符
使用Unicode字符是一种直接且灵活的方法,可以在Excel表格中准确地标注拼音声调。
1、Unicode字符表
Unicode字符表提供了带有声调的拼音字母,如ā, á, ǎ, à等。你可以通过查找这些字符的Unicode编码,然后在Excel中使用这些编码来生成带声调的拼音字母。
2、插入Unicode字符
在Excel中,您可以通过以下步骤插入Unicode字符:
- 打开Excel表格,选择要插入拼音声调的位置。
- 在单元格中输入公式“=UNICHAR(Unicode编码)”,例如“=UNICHAR(462)”来生成“ǎ”。
- 按Enter键确认,单元格中将显示带声调的拼音字母。
这种方法的优点是可以精确地标注拼音声调,但需要记住或查找Unicode编码。
二、借助拼音输入法
借助拼音输入法可以快速地在Excel表格中输入带声调的拼音字母。
1、安装拼音输入法
首先,您需要安装支持拼音声调的输入法,如搜狗拼音输入法、谷歌拼音输入法等。
2、输入拼音声调
使用拼音输入法输入拼音声调的方法如下:
- 打开Excel表格,选择要输入拼音声调的位置。
- 切换到拼音输入法,输入拼音字母和对应的声调数字。例如,输入“a1”生成“ā”,“a2”生成“á”,“a3”生成“ǎ”,“a4”生成“à”。
- 选择正确的拼音字母,按Enter键确认。
这种方法的优点是操作简单、快捷,但需要依赖拼音输入法。
三、利用Excel函数
利用Excel函数可以在Excel表格中自动生成带声调的拼音字母。
1、自定义函数
您可以通过自定义Excel函数来实现拼音声调的标注。例如,使用VBA编写一个函数,将输入的拼音字母和声调数字转换为带声调的拼音字母。
1.1、编写VBA代码
- 打开Excel表格,按Alt+F11打开VBA编辑器。
- 在VBA编辑器中,选择“插入”->“模块”,创建一个新模块。
- 在模块中输入以下代码:
Function PinyinWithTone(pinyin As String) As String
Dim tones As Variant
tones = Array("ā", "á", "ǎ", "à", "ē", "é", "ě", "è", "ī", "í", "ǐ", "ì", "ō", "ó", "ǒ", "ò", "ū", "ú", "ǔ", "ù", "ǖ", "ǘ", "ǚ", "ǜ")
Dim base As String
Dim tone As Integer
base = Left(pinyin, Len(pinyin) - 1)
tone = CInt(Right(pinyin, 1))
PinyinWithTone = Replace(base, Mid(base, Len(base), 1), tones((Asc(Mid(base, Len(base), 1)) - 97) * 4 + tone - 1))
End Function
1.2、使用自定义函数
- 返回Excel表格,选择要输入拼音声调的位置。
- 在单元格中输入公式“=PinyinWithTone(“拼音和声调”)”,例如“=PinyinWithTone(“a3”)”来生成“ǎ”。
- 按Enter键确认,单元格中将显示带声调的拼音字母。
这种方法的优点是可以批量处理大量拼音声调,但需要一定的编程基础。
四、比较三种方法的优缺点
1、使用Unicode字符
优点:精确、灵活。
缺点:需要记住或查找Unicode编码。
2、借助拼音输入法
优点:操作简单、快捷。
缺点:依赖拼音输入法,不能批量处理。
3、利用Excel函数
优点:可以批量处理大量拼音声调。
缺点:需要一定的编程基础。
五、实际应用案例
1、教育领域
在教育领域,特别是汉语拼音教学中,标注拼音声调是必不可少的。使用Excel表格标注拼音声调可以帮助教师快速、准确地准备教学材料,提高教学效率。
2、语言学习
对于学习汉语的外国学生来说,标注拼音声调可以帮助他们更好地掌握汉语发音规则。Excel表格可以用来制作学习卡片或发音练习表。
3、词典编制
在编制电子词典时,标注拼音声调是非常重要的。使用Excel表格可以方便地管理和更新词条信息,提高词典编制效率。
六、常见问题及解决方案
1、Unicode字符显示不正确
如果在Excel中插入的Unicode字符显示不正确,可能是由于Excel版本或字体问题。建议升级Excel版本或更换支持Unicode字符的字体。
2、拼音输入法无法输入声调
如果拼音输入法无法输入声调,可能是输入法设置问题。建议检查输入法设置,确保启用了声调输入功能。
3、自定义函数报错
如果在使用自定义函数时出现错误,可能是由于VBA代码有误或Excel安全设置问题。建议检查VBA代码,确保无误,并调整Excel安全设置,允许宏运行。
七、总结
在Excel表格中标注拼音声调的方法主要包括使用Unicode字符、借助拼音输入法、利用Excel函数。这些方法各有优缺点,适用于不同的应用场景。通过掌握这些方法,您可以在Excel表格中快速、准确地标注拼音声调,提高工作效率。
相关问答FAQs:
1. 表格中如何设置拼音声调?
在Excel表格中,您可以通过以下步骤来标注拼音声调:
- 选择需要标注拼音声调的单元格或者一列/一行的单元格。
- 点击Excel中的“插入”选项卡。
- 在“插入”选项卡中,找到“符号”组,并点击“符号”组中的“符号”按钮。
- 在弹出的“符号”对话框中,选择“字体”为“Kaiti SC”(或其他支持拼音声调的字体)。
- 在“符号”对话框中,找到您需要的拼音声调符号,并点击“插入”按钮。
- 重复上述步骤,将所有需要标注拼音声调的单元格都标注完成。
2. 如何自动为Excel表格中的文字添加拼音声调?
如果您希望自动为Excel表格中的文字添加拼音声调,可以使用Excel中的“文本转换”功能来实现:
- 选择需要添加拼音声调的单元格或者一列/一行的单元格。
- 点击Excel中的“数据”选项卡。
- 在“数据”选项卡中,找到“文本转换”组,并点击“文本转换”按钮。
- 在弹出的“文本转换”对话框中,选择“汉字转拼音声调”选项。
- 点击“确定”按钮,Excel会自动为所选单元格中的文字添加拼音声调。
3. 如何在Excel表格中调整拼音声调的位置?
如果您需要调整Excel表格中拼音声调的位置,可以按照以下步骤进行操作:
- 选择已标注拼音声调的单元格或者一列/一行的单元格。
- 在Excel的顶部工具栏中,找到“开始”选项卡。
- 在“开始”选项卡中,找到“字体”组,并点击“字体”组中的“字体”按钮。
- 在弹出的“字体”对话框中,选择“样式”选项卡。
- 在“样式”选项卡中,找到“位置”选项,并选择您希望的拼音声调位置,如“上标”、“下标”等。
- 点击“确定”按钮,Excel会根据您的选择调整拼音声调的位置。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4350091